Abstract
The utility model relates to a PCB, and especially relates to an induction type PCB. The PCB comprises a conducting layer, an insulating layer, and a heat radiation layer. The insulating layer is disposed on the heat radiation layer. The conducting layer is disposed on the insulating layer. A gradienter is fixed on a surface of the conducting layer. Induction buzzers are disposed on side ends of the conducting layer. The induction buzzers are connected with the gradienter. The PCB can be ensured to be in a level condition, and prevents to be out-of-level.

Embodiment
If Fig. 1 is structural representation of the present utility model, induction type pcb board, comprise conductive layer 1, insulating barrier 2 and heat dissipating layer 3, heat dissipating layer 3 is provided with insulating barrier 2, insulating barrier 2 is provided with conductive layer 1, conductive layer is fixed with level meter 4 on 1 surface, and conductive layer 1 side is also provided with induction buzzer 5, and induction buzzer 5 is connected with level meter 4.
When pcb board is not horizontal, level meter 4 there will be skewed, the induction buzzer 5 being at this moment connected with the level meter sound that will give the alarm, and prompting staff is until recover horizontal level, this pcb board can guarantee that it is in level, has avoided having caused because of out-of-level.
